Nominating Member definition

Nominating Member means a Nominating Member
Nominating Member means (i) the Member providing the notice of the nomination proposed to be made at a general meeting, (ii) the beneficial owner or beneficial owners, if different, on whose behalf the notice of the nomination proposed to be made at any general meeting is made, and (iii) any affiliate or associate of such stockholder or beneficial owner.

Nominating Member means each of the AG Member, the BlackRock Member, the Carlyle Member, the BSP Member or any Major Transferee of such Members, in each case so long as such Person holds a number of Designated Units at least equal to the Minimum Threshold and does not otherwise Transfer and assign, in accordance with the terms and conditions of this Agreement (including Section 6.2(d)), its rights under Section 6.2 with respect to the designation of directors.
Nominating Member means the Member that nominated the Director, Officer or committee member with respect to his or her service to the Corporation. With respect to CCMCN, CCMCN and each community health center that is a member of CCMCN shall be separately considered a Nominating Member with respect to the Director nominated by CCMCN.
